Getting to Ireland
Travelling to Ireland is no different to travelling to any other modern country. Ireland is easily accessible thanks to a wide range of international airline connections to capital cities and key transport hubs around the world.
Business travellers have a choice of many regular airline routes from the UK, US, Canada, Africa, Middle East and Europe. If you’re on a tight schedule, it may not take as long as you expect to reach our shores. London is just over an hour away, while New York can be as little as five hours travel.
Belfast is serviced by two airports, George Best Belfast City Airport close to the city centre and Belfast International Airport, 25 minutes from the city centre. Belfast is also well connected to Dublin with driving time from Dublin Airport to Belfast taking approximately 90 minutes. Derry~Londonderry city in the north west region is serviced by the City of Derry Airport 10 minutes from the city centre, with connections to London Stansted Airport and many other UK and European destinations.
